DE   Quantitative PCR method for detection of soybean event 305423
DE   (Mazzara et al., 2009).

FT   STS             1..93
FT                   /standard_name="PCR 93 bp amplicon"
FT                   /note="event-specific RT-PCR"
FT                   /target="3' integration border region (IBR) between the insert of soybean event 305423 and the soybean host genome"
FT   primer_bind     1..21
FT                   /standard_name="Primer forward: DP305-f1"
FT                   /note="CGTGTTCTCTTTTTGGCTAGC"
FT                   /target="insert"
FT   primer_bind     complement(33..64)
FT                   /standard_name="RT-PCR probe: DP305-p"
FT                   /note="FAM-TGACACAAATGATTTTCATACAAAAGTCGAGA-TAMRA"
FT   primer_bind     complement(66..93)
FT                   /standard_name="Primer reverse: DP305-r5"
FT                   /note="GTGACCAATGAATACATAACACAAACTA"
FT                   /target="3'-host genome"
